    Optimal Implementation of Irrigation Practices: Cost-Effective Desertification Action Plan for the Pinios Basin

    Source: Journal of Water Resources Planning and Management:;2014:;Volume ( 140 ):;issue: 010
    Author:
    Y. Panagopoulos
    ,
    C. Makropoulos
    ,
    M. Kossida
    ,
    M. Mimikou
    DOI: 10.1061/(ASCE)WR.1943-5452.0000428
    Publisher: American Society of Civil Engineers
    Abstract: The effort to manage irrigation water use through the adoption and implementation of agricultural best management practices (BMPs) is crucial for meeting water bodies’ sustainability in water-deficient agricultural areas. This paper presents the development of an efficient decision support tool able to suggest the optimal location for placing high- and low-tech irrigation BMPs, such as deficit irrigation, conveyance efficiency improvement, precision irrigation, and wastewater reuse, and demonstrates its application in the water-scarce Pinios river basin in central Greece. The tool uses the SWAT (soil and water assessment tool) model as the BMP and hydrologic simulator and a multiobjective genetic algorithm, which, based on calculated cost data, optimizes the cost-effectiveness of management schemes across the landscape.
